铣孔编程格式是什么
-
铣孔编程格式是用于控制数控铣床进行孔加工的程序格式。在编写铣孔程序时,需要按照一定规范来描述每个孔的位置、尺寸、深度和加工路径等信息,以便机床能够正确地执行孔加工操作。
通常,铣孔编程格式包括以下几个方面的内容:
-
程序开始和结束:一般以%符号开头和结尾,表示程序的开始和结束。
-
坐标系设定:通过G代码指令来设定工件坐标系,常见的包括G54、G55等。这样可以确定机床工具的坐标和工件的坐标之间的关系。
-
刀具选择和换刀:使用T代码指令来选择刀具,通常需要通过M代码指令来控制刀具的换装操作。
-
运动方式选择:通过G代码指令来选择合适的运动方式,常见的有G00(快速定位)、G01(直线插补)、G02(圆弧插补)和G03(圆弧插补)等。根据具体的孔形状,选择合适的运动方式使刀具能够正确地沿着预定路径进行插补运动。
-
孔位置和尺寸指定:使用G代码指令和X、Y、Z轴的数值来指定孔的位置。根据实际需要,还可以通过R、I、J等参数来指定圆弧孔的半径或中心点坐标。
-
深度和加工路径设定:使用Z轴的数值来指定孔的深度。同时,也可以通过G代码指令和R、I、J等参数来设定加工的路径,以控制刀具的切削轨迹。
-
切削参数设定:使用F代码指令来设定切削进给速度,以控制刀具的切削速度和加工效率。
-
循环重复:使用循环结构来重复执行相同的孔加工操作,以实现批量加工的需求。
综上所述,铣孔编程格式是一种规范化的程序格式,用于描述数控铣床进行孔加工的相关信息。合理的铣孔编程格式可以提高加工效率、减少误差,并确保加工质量和精度。
1年前 -
-
铣孔编程格式是一种用于数控铣床的编程方法,用于指导机床进行孔加工操作。这种编程格式主要包括以下几个方面:
-
孔的位置和尺寸:编程格式中需要明确指定每个孔的坐标位置和尺寸大小。通常使用直角坐标系或极坐标系表示,可以使用绝对坐标或增量坐标表示。
-
切削参数:编程格式中需要指定切削参数,如进给速度、转速、切削进给量等。这些参数根据具体的材料和孔的尺寸来确定,旨在确保切削过程具有最佳效果。
-
切削路径:编程格式中需要指定切削路径,即机床在加工孔时的运动轨迹。常见的切削路径包括直线插补、圆弧插补和螺旋插补等。切削路径的选择要考虑到孔的形状和加工要求。
-
孔的加工顺序:编程格式中需要指定不同孔的加工顺序,即按照什么顺序加工孔。这是为了避免切削冲突和提高加工效率。
-
安全和刀具补偿:编程格式中需要考虑安全性和刀具补偿问题。例如,要确保机床在加工过程中不会与工件或刀具碰撞,并根据实际情况进行刀具半径补偿或长度补偿。
总的来说,铣孔编程格式是一种将孔的位置、尺寸、切削参数、切削路径、加工顺序、安全和刀具补偿等信息整合起来的编程方法,用于指导机床进行孔加工操作。这种编程格式可以大大提高加工的精度和效率,减少人工操作的繁琐程度。
1年前 -
-
铣孔编程格式是指在数控铣床上进行孔加工时,编写的程序格式。铣孔编程格式大致分为绝对式编程和增量式编程两种形式。
绝对式编程是指以参考坐标系为基准,通过设定绝对坐标值来描述加工点的位置。具体的编程格式如下:
-
G代码:G90(绝对式编程)
在绝对式编程中,使用G90代码来指示机床以绝对坐标模式进行加工。 -
X坐标:X__ (加工点的X轴坐标值)
指定加工点在X轴上的位置。 -
Y坐标:Y__ (加工点的Y轴坐标值)
指定加工点在Y轴上的位置。 -
Z坐标:Z__ (加工点的Z轴坐标值)
指定加工点在Z轴上的位置。 -
F进给速度:F__ (进给速度值)
指定加工过程中的进给速度。
例如:
G90 ;绝对式编程
X10 ;X轴坐标值为10
Y20 ;Y轴坐标值为20
Z30 ;Z轴坐标值为30
F100 ;进给速度为100增量式编程是指以上一刀具位置为基准,通过设定相对坐标值来描述加工点的位置。具体的编程格式如下:
-
G代码:G91(增量式编程)
在增量式编程中,使用G91代码来指示机床以增量坐标模式进行加工。 -
X坐标:X__ (相对于上一刀具位置的X轴坐标增量值)
指定加工点在X轴上的相对增量。 -
Y坐标:Y__ (相对于上一刀具位置的Y轴坐标增量值)
指定加工点在Y轴上的相对增量。 -
Z坐标:Z__ (相对于上一刀具位置的Z轴坐标增量值)
指定加工点在Z轴上的相对增量。 -
F进给速度:F__ (进给速度值)
指定加工过程中的进给速度。
例如:
G91 ;增量式编程
X10 ;X轴坐标增量为10
Y20 ;Y轴坐标增量为20
Z30 ;Z轴坐标增量为30
F100 ;进给速度为100以上就是铣孔编程格式的基本内容,根据实际加工需求可以灵活组合使用。在实际操作过程中,还需要考虑刀具的选用、切削参数的设定等因素,以确保加工质量和效率。
1年前 -